EXHIBIT 10.1 EXCHANGE AGREEMENT BY AND AMONG EZCOMM ENTERPRISES, INC., EUGENE SCIENCE INC., AND CERTAIN SHAREHOLDERS OF EUGENE SCIENCE INC. DATED AS OF SEPTEMBER 1, 2005 EXCHANGE AGREEMENT THIS EXCHANGE AGREEMENT (the "AGREEMENT") is made and entered into as of September 1, 2005, by and among Ezcomm Enterprises, Inc., a Delaware corporation (the "COMPANY"); Eugene Science Inc., a Korean corporation ("EUGENE"); and each of the shareholders of Eugene who may, from time to time, execute a counterpart signature page to this Agreement (each, a "SHAREHOLDER" and collectively, the "SHAREHOLDERS"). RECITALS A. The Shareholders own outstanding shares of Eugene (the "EUGENE SHARES"). B. The parties desire to have the Company combine the respective businesses of the Company and Eugene by means of the acquisition by the Company of the Eugene Shares and the acquisition by the Shareholders of equity securities in the Company, in exchange for the consideration and on the terms and conditions hereinafter set forth. NOW, THEREFORE, in consideration of the covenants, promises and representations set forth herein, and for other good and valuable consideration, the receipt and sufficiency of which are hereby acknowledged, the parties agree as follows: ARTICLE I EXCHANGE -------- 1.1 GENERAL. At the Closing and subject to and upon the terms and conditions of this Agreement: (i) the Shareholders agree to contribute, transfer, assign and deliver to the Company, and the Company agrees to acquire from the Shareholders, all of the outstanding Eugene Shares owned by the Shareholders as specifically set forth on SCHEDULE 1.1 hereto; and (ii) the Company agrees to issue to the Shareholders, and the Shareholders agree to acquire from the Company, that number of shares of Common Stock, par value $0.0001 per share, of the Company (the "COMPANY SHARES") as is determined pursuant to SECTION 1.3 below. The transactions set forth above and the other transactions contemplated hereunder shall be referred to herein as the "TRANSACTION" or the "TRANSACTIONS". 1.2 CLOSING. Unless this Agreement shall have been terminated pursuant to ARTICLE IX hereof, the closing of the Transaction (the "CLOSING") shall take place at the offices of Stubbs Alderton & Markiles, LLP, 15821 Ventura Boulevard, Suite 525, Encino, CA 91436 at a time and date to be specified by the parties, which shall be no later than the third business day after the satisfaction or waiver of the conditions set forth in ARTICLE VII, or at such other time, date and location as the parties hereto agree in writing (the "CLOSING DATE"). 1.3 CONSIDERATION. In exchange for a U.S. Dollar amount equal to three (3) Korean Won per Eugene Share and the additional agreements of the Company set forth herein, the Shareholders shall transfer all of the Eugene Shares to the Company. In exchange for a U.S. Dollar amount equal to .325603 Korean Won per Company Share and the additional agreements of the Shareholders set forth herein, the Company shall issue to each Shareholder 9.213678 Company Shares (the "COMPANY SHARE RATIO") multiplied by the number of Eugene Shares acquired by the Company under this Agreement from such Shareholder. The Company covenants and agrees that, assuming all the holders of Eugene's outstanding shares transfer their Eugene Shares to the Company pursuant to this Agreement, there will be 353,688,000 shares of capital stock of the Company issued and outstanding, and the Company Shares issued under this Agreement shall represent 90% of the issued and outstanding shares of capital stock of the Company, immediately following the Closing. The cash and shares to be transferred as set forth above shall be delivered to Eugene as custodian and attorney-in-fact for the Shareholders, pursuant to a Custody Agreement, Share Agreement and a Power-of-Attorney as prepared by Korean counsel in accordance with Korean law and duly executed by the Shareholders. 1.4 NO FRACTIONAL SHARES. No fractional Company Shares shall be issued in the Transaction. If the number of shares a holder of Eugene Shares holds immediately prior to the Closing multiplied by the Company Share Ratio would result in the issuance of a fractional Company Share, that product will be rounded down to the nearest whole number of Company Shares if it is less than the fraction of one-half (.5) of one Company Share or rounded up to the nearest whole number of shares of Common Stock if the said product is equal to or greater than the fraction of one-half (.5) of one Company Share. 1.5 DELIVERY OF TRANSFER DOCUMENTS. At the Closing, the Company shall deliver certificates representing the Company Shares to the Shareholders and each Shareholder shall deliver an assignment or other acceptable instrument of transfer of the Eugene Shares owned by such Shareholder, duly executed by such Shareholder, together with (i) all such other documents as may be reasonably requested to vest in the Company good and marketable title to the Eugene Shares free and clear of any and all Liens (as defined in SECTION 2.3 hereof) and (ii) all other reasonably necessary documentary stamps. Eugene shall record the transfer of the Eugene Shares described in this SECTION 1.5 on the Eugene stock transfer books. 1.6 ISSUANCE OF CERTIFICATES REPRESENTING COMPANY SHARES. At the Closing, the Company will issue Company Shares to the Shareholders as provided in SECTION 1.3 above (subject to SECTION 1.4). Company Shares, when issued hereunder, shall be restricted shares and may not be sold, transferred or otherwise disposed of by the Shareholders without registration under the Securities Act, or an available exemption from registration under the United Stated Securities Act of 1933, as amended (the "SECURITIES ACT"). The certificates representing Company Shares will contain the appropriate restrictive legends. At or prior to Closing, the Company may require the Shareholders to execute and deliver an investment representation letter or similar document containing such representations as may, in the Company's reasonably opinion, be required to comply with applicable provisions of the Securities Act. 1.7 REMAINING EUGENE SHARES. (a) If less than all the outstanding Eugene Shares are transferred to the Company at the Closing (any such Eugene Shares are referred to as the "REMAINING EUGENE SHARES"), then promptly following the Closing the Company will deposit in trust with Eugene as custodian for the Shareholders, the cash consideration payable and the Company Shares issuable pursuant to SECTION 1.3 to the holders of the Remaining Eugene Shares (the "REMAINING SHARE FUND"). 2 (b) No dividends or other distributions declared or made after the date of this Agreement with respect to Company Shares with a record date after the Closing Date will be paid to the holders of any Remaining Eugene Shares until the holders of record of such Remaining Eugene Shares shall transfer such Remaining Eugene Shares to the Company and acquire such Company Shares from the Company in accordance with the terms hereof. Subject to applicable law, promptly following the transfer of any such Remaining Eugene Shares and the acquisition of the Company Shares, Eugene, as custodian, shall deliver to the record holders thereof, without interest, certificates representing the Company Shares issuable to such holders against delivery of the applicable consideration therefore. (c) Any portion of the Remaining Share Fund which remains undistributed for one (1) year after the Closing Date shall be delivered to the Company, upon demand of the Company, and any Shareholders who have not theretofore complied with the provisions of this SECTION 1.7 shall thereafter look only to the Company for the Company Shares to which they are entitled pursuant hereto. 1.8 TAX CONSEQUENCES. It is intended by the parties hereto that for United States income tax purposes, the contribution and transfer of the Eugene Shares by the Shareholders to the Company in exchange for Company Shares constitutes a tax-deferred exchange within the meaning of Section 351 of the Code. 1.9 TAKING OF NECESSARY ACTION; FURTHER ACTION. If, at any time after the Closing, any further action is necessary or desirable to carry out the purposes of this Agreement, including qualifying the Transaction as a tax-deferred exchange within the meaning of Section 351 of the Code, and to vest the Company with full right, title and possession to Eugene Shares, the parties shall take all such lawful and necessary action.
